July 29th 2018 Update

I mentioned last week that I was working on a short story after the events of Down with the Queen, and I finished that easily enough. Nothing even as exciting as A Date Gone Awry, just information that I’d feel bad skipping, yet which doesn’t fit into DwtQ or into whatever I name the next book.

Once I finished that, I went ahead and started on Queen of Ice. I don’t have much written so far, just ~2,500 words, but it’s a start. I did get artwork for it, though, so here’s the cover art by June Jenssen!

Queen of Ice Small

Finally, I have a bit of other news on Through the Fire, regarding the entire trilogy. I’ve come to an agreement with Tantor Media, and they’ll be producing audiobooks of the trilogy as they come out, though I can’t tell you exactly how long it’ll take them to be produced. I’ll be sending them the files as soon as they have the final version of The Avatar’s Flames, so that they can get started on it.

I have to admit I’m a little nervous to send The Avatar’s Flames into the wild, but that’s how it goes. About three weeks to release!

I don’t have anything else big to let everyone know about, so that’s it for this week.
